Systems, methods, and graphical user interfaces for annotating, measuring, and modeling environments

    Abstract: A computer system displays an annotation placement user interface that includes a representation of a field of view of one or more cameras that is updated over time based on changes in the field of view, and a placement user interface element indicating a virtual annotation placement location. If the placement user interface element is over a representation of a first type of physical feature, the annotation placement user interface operates in a first annotation mode for adding annotations of a first type. In response to detecting movement of the one or more cameras relative to the physical environment, the system updates the representation of the field of view. If the placement user interface element is over a representation of a second, different type of physical feature, the annotation placement user interface operates in a second, different annotation mode for adding annotations of a second, different type.

    Devices, Methods, and Graphical User Interfaces for System-Wide Behavior for 3D Models

    Abstract: A computer system having a display generation component, one or more input devices, one or more cameras, and one or more attitude sensors receives a request to display an augmented reality view of a physical environment in a first user interface region that includes a representation of a field of view of the one or more cameras. In response to receiving the request, in accordance with a determination that calibration criteria are not met, a calibration user interface object is displayed. In response to detecting a change in attitude of the one or more cameras in the physical environment, at least one display parameter of the calibration user interface object is adjusted in accordance with the detected change. In response to detecting that the calibration criteria are met, the calibration user interface object ceases to be displayed.
